19th Annual Lake Cushing Crossing
May 9, 2009
This annual Squaw Valley spring tradition is Lake Tahoe's original "pond crossing" event and a must-see (or must do)! Come to the base of KT-22 and grab your spot around the pond and enjoy the wacky costumes and crazy crossings. The event starts at 2pm with registration (limited to the first 50 entrants) begins at noon on the KT-22 Sundeck.
This event has been re-scheduled to Saturday, May 9!
Registration: Noon on the KT-22 Sundeck.
Entry: $15 per category (Mens and Womens Ski, Snowboard and Open categories)
Rules: Helmets and personal flotation devices are mandatory. All registrants must be over 18 and must sign a liability release. Crossing devices must be controllable and any tandem entries must be secured to the same crossing device (ie. you cannot ski or board separately but can be bound to the same crossing device).
Contestants are judged on creativity and crossing.
Overall Winner: Silver Season Pass
Remaining Category Winners: $100
